>백엔드 개발 >파이썬 튜토리얼 >연산자, 조건부 및 입력

연산자, 조건부 및 입력

WBOY
WBOY원래의
2024-07-27 00:11:14736검색

Operators, Conditionals and Inputs

운영자

연산자는 컴퓨터에 특정 수학적 또는 논리적 연산을 수행하도록 지시하는 기호입니다.

1. 산술 연산자

이러한 연산자는 덧셈, 뺄셈, 곱셈, 나눗셈과 같은 기본적인 수학 연산을 수행합니다.

*더하기(+): 두 개의 숫자를 더합니다.
예:

>>>print(1+3)

*뺄셈(-): 한 숫자에서 다른 숫자를 뺍니다.
예:

>>>print(1-3)

곱셈(): 두 숫자를 곱합니다.
예:

>>>print(1*3)

*나누기(/): 한 숫자를 다른 숫자로 나눕니다.
예:

>>>print(1/3)

*바닥 나누기(//): 한 숫자를 다른 숫자로 나누고 가장 가까운 정수로 내림합니다.
예:

>>>print(1//3)

*계수(%): 한 숫자를 다른 숫자로 나눈 나머지를 반환합니다.
예:

>>>print(1%3)

지수(*): 한 숫자를 다른 숫자의 거듭제곱으로 만듭니다.
예:

>>>print(1**3)

2.비교 연산자

이 연산자는 두 값을 비교하여 True 또는 False를 반환합니다.

*같음(==): 두 값이 같은지 확인합니다.

>>>a = 5
>>>b = 3
>>>result = (a == b)  

>>>result is False

*같지 않음(!=): 두 값이 같지 않은지 확인합니다.

>>>a = 5
>>>b = 3
>>>result = (a != b)  

>>>result is True

*보다 큼(>): 한 값이 다른 값보다 큰지 확인합니다.

>>>a = 5
>>>b = 3
>>>result = (a > b)  

>>>result is True

*보다 작음(<): 한 값이 다른 값보다 작은지 확인합니다.

>>>a = 5
>>>b = 3
>>>result = (a < b)  

>>>result is False




</p>
<p>*크거나 같음(>=): 한 값이 다른 값보다 크거나 같은지 확인합니다.<br>
</p>

<pre class="brush:php;toolbar:false">>>>a = 5
>>>b = 3
>>>result = (a >= b)  

>>>result is True

*작거나 같음(<=): 한 값이 다른 값보다 작거나 같은지 확인

>>>a = 5
>>>b = 3
>>>result = (a <= b)  
>>>result is False




</p>
<h3>
  
  
  3.논리 연산자
</h3>

<p>이 연산자는 조건문을 결합하는 데 사용됩니다.</p>

<p>*and: 두 문장이 모두 true인 경우 True를 반환합니다.<br>
</p>

<pre class="brush:php;toolbar:false">>>>a = 5
>>>b = 3
>>>result = (a > b and a > 0)  

>>>result is True

*또는: 진술 중 하나가 참인 경우 True를 반환합니다.

>>>a = 5
>>>b = 3
>>>result = (a > b or a < 0)  
>>>result is True

*not: 결과를 반전하고, 결과가 true이면 False를 반환합니다.

>>>a = 5
>>>result = not (a > 0)  

>>>result is False

조건부

조건부는 코드의 교통 신호와 같습니다. 이는 프로그램이 특정 조건에 따라 취할 경로를 결정하는 데 도움이 됩니다.

1. if 문

if 문은 조건을 확인하고 조건이 True이면 코드 블록을 실행합니다.
예:

>>>a = 5
>>>b = 3
>>>if a > b:
    print("a is greater than b")

2. elif 문

elif 문은 "else if"의 줄임말입니다. 이전 if 조건이 False인 경우 다른 조건을 확인합니다.
예:

>>>a = 5
>>>b = 5
>>>if a > b:
    print("a is greater than b")
>>>elif a == b:
    print("a is equal to b")

3. else 문

else 문은 이전 조건에서 포착하지 못한 모든 것을 포착합니다.
예:

>>>a = 3
>>>b = 5
>>>if a > b:
    print("a is greater than b")
>>>elif a == b:
    print("a is equal to b")
>>>else:
    print("a is less than b")

위 내용은 연산자, 조건부 및 입력의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.